#af3cae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af3cae is composed of 68.6% red, 23.5%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#af3cae color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78ff with #5f005d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#af3cae color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#af3cae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#af3cae has RGB values of R:175, G:60,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.01,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11484334.

Shades and Tints of #af3cae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#af3cae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797279 is the less saturated color, while #e506e3 is the most saturated one.
